Output 952837190e2cac62f3843900940517bb23fcbd2fb25689aa4f443e78694558f8:1

value
2167567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fb15d4abbdaeaaf2978c05cfb432b4900431bc9 OP_EQUAL
address
38xPnCEGM5fUFBZ92BJ2EZzazuHyiFAJ6N
transaction
952837190e2cac62f3843900940517bb23fcbd2fb25689aa4f443e78694558f8
spent
true